Priyanka From Rae Bareli & Rahul From Amethi?

Congress to hold meeting of the party’s Central Election Committee to decide the first list of candidates for the Lok Sabha polls…reports Asian Lite News

Congress leader Priyanka Gandhi Vadra will likely make her electoral debut from the party’s Uttar Pradesh stronghold of Raebareli – a seat won thrice by ex-Prime Minister Indira Gandhi – sources said.

Rahul Gandhi, meanwhile, may return to the Congress’ other UP stronghold – Amethi – which he lost in a shock defeat to the Bharatiya Janata Party’s Smriti Irani in 2019. Gandhi will also fight from his current seat of Wayanad in Kerala; victory here had allowed him to retain his Lok Sabha status after the last election.

There has always been a ‘will she, won’t she’ air about Ms Gandhi Vadra and elections. Before 2019 she set tongues wagging after quipping “why not”, when asked if she would contest from Varanasi –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s bastion.

Her entry now comes after her mother, ex-party boss Sonia Gandhi – said she would not seek re-election from Raebareli, a seat she has won five times in the past, including in 2019.

In that election she was the sole Congress leader to win a UP Lok Sabha seat. Gandhi’s Lok Sabha-to-Rajya Sabha shift – she has been elected from Rajasthan – was supposed to signal a shift in party leadership before the general election.

As she did so, she made an emotional appeal to Raebareli’s voters, which has been won by a member of the Gandhi family in all but three general elections since independence.

After the Congress confirmed Sonia Gandhi’s withdrawal from Raebareli, there was speculation Priyanka Gandhi Vadra would finally contest an election.

There were even posters in Raebareli this week urging the Congress to name Ms Gandhi Vadra as its candidate for the prestigious seat. “Take Congress’ development work forward, Raebareli is calling… Priyanka Gandhiji, please come,” the posters said. The Congress has now responded to that call.

In 2019, Smriti Irani beat Rahul Gandhi by 55,000-odd votes for one of the biggest upsets of the election. The BJP has allowed her to defend the seat and, last week, she challenged Mr Gandhi.

“In 2019 he left Amethi. Today Amethi has left him. If he is confident then, without going to Wayanad… let him fight from Amethi,” she told NDTV, as Mr Gandhi’s ‘Bharat Jodo Nyay Yatra’ entered the constituency. “Empty roads tell us what people feel about Rahul Gandhi.”

The BJP has not yet announced its Raebareli candidate; in 2019 the party fielded Dinesh Pratap Singh, who slumped to defeat by over 1.8 lakh votes in the constituency.

The party has, however, confirmed that Ms Irani will defend her Amethi seat, setting up the first of two blockbuster contests in the politically significant state of Uttar Pradesh.

Congress CEC to meet today

Congress will hold a meeting of the party’s Central Election Committee on Thursday to decide the first list of candidates for the Lok Sabha polls.

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ge is the chairperson of the committee and its members include former party chiefs Sonia Gandhi and Rahul Gandhi.

“The first meeting of @INCIndia Central Election Committee(CEC) that considers and decides on candidates for Lok Sabha polls is being held at 6 pm on March 7th,” Congress leader Jairam Ramesh said in a tweet.

The Congress panel tasked with preparing the party’s manifesto for the Lok Sabha polls has prepared the draft which will now be discussed by the Congress Working Committee.

Former Finance Minister P Chidambaram, who heads the manifesto committee, said on Tuesday that the draft report will be presented to the Congress president.

“We have prepared the draft manifesto. Now it will go to the Congress Working Committee. They will finalize the manifesto then it will become the Congress party document. Tomorrow we will hand over this draft to the Congress President,” he said.

The Lok Sabha polls are likely to be held in April-May this year.

‘Caste census is an X-ray for India’

Earlier, Rahul Gandhi has said that an X-ray is conducted when a hand bone is broken and similarly, the caste census is an X-ray for India. The Congress leader made the remark while addressing a public gathering during his Bharat Jodo Nyay Yatra in Ratlam district in the state on Wednesday.

“Firstly, we will have to get an X-ray done for India. An X-ray is conducted when a hand bone is broken. Similarly, the caste census is an X-ray for India,” Rahul Gandhi said.

Earlier, Congress General Secretary in-charge Communications Jairam Ramesh also said that conducting a socio-economic caste census is one of the two guarantees announced by the Congress party.

“Rahul Gandhi is continuously speaking about nyaya (justice) which is Nari Nyay, Yuva Nyay, Kisan Nyay, Shramik Nyay, and Hissedari Nyay. Till now Rahul Gandhi and Congress President Kharge have talked about two guarantees associated with Kisan Nyay and Hissedari Nyay. First, passing a law granting legal status to MSP in Parliament for farmers and the MSP will be based on the formula suggested by M S Swaminathan. Second, conducting a socio-economic caste census, which will be an important step for social empowerment and economic justice,” Ramesh said. (ANI)
